构建高效HTML项目管理系统:提升开发效率与团队协作的完整指南
引言:项目管理的挑战与机遇
在当今数字化转型加速的背景下,软件开发项目面临需求频繁变更、团队跨地域协作、进度跟踪困难等多重挑战。传统项目管理工具如Excel表格或独立桌面软件已无法满足现代开发流程的动态需求,而基于HTML的轻量化项目管理系统凭借其跨平台性、易维护性和实时协作能力,成为企业提升开发效率的首选方案。据Gartner 2023年报告,采用现代化项目管理工具的企业,项目交付周期平均缩短27%,团队协作效率提升35%。本文将从需求分析、技术实现到落地实践,提供一套可复用的完整构建指南,助您打造高效、灵活的项目管理生态。
一、HTML项目管理系统的核心价值与定义
HTML项目管理系统并非指单一技术工具,而是基于Web标准(HTML5、CSS3、JavaScript)构建的轻量级应用,通过浏览器即可访问,无需安装客户端。其核心价值体现在三方面:首先,**零部署门槛**,团队成员无论使用Windows、MacOS或移动设备,只需浏览器即可实时同步数据;其次,**高度可定制化**,开发者可根据团队流程调整界面布局和功能模块;最后,**无缝集成能力**,可与主流开发工具链(如GitLab、Jira、Slack)通过API实现数据互通。
以某金融科技公司为例,其团队曾使用纸质任务板管理15人项目,导致需求遗漏率高达40%。实施基于HTML的系统后,通过可视化看板(如使用Sortable.js实现拖拽排序),需求遗漏率降至5%以下,任务完成平均耗时缩短45%。这印证了系统化工具对流程规范化的关键作用。
二、核心功能模块设计与实现逻辑
2.1 任务管理引擎:从静态到动态
任务模块是系统的核心骨架。传统方式依赖固定模板,而现代系统需支持动态规则。例如:
- 智能分配逻辑:根据成员技能标签(如前端/后端)自动分配任务,避免“人手不足”或“能力错配”。代码示例:使用JavaScript的Map数据结构存储技能标签,通过算法匹配任务需求。
- 进度可视化:采用甘特图(如使用D3.js库)展示任务依赖关系。某电商团队通过此功能,将跨团队协作的阻塞点识别时间从2天缩短至1小时。
2.2 协作通信中枢:打破信息孤岛
项目管理系统必须整合沟通渠道。关键实现包括:
- 嵌入式讨论区:在任务详情页内嵌实时聊天(如WebSocket实现),避免在Slack或邮件中反复切换。实测显示,减少上下文切换可提升单次任务处理效率22%。
- 文件版本控制:集成简单文件管理,支持自动记录修改历史(如使用localStorage模拟基础版本控制),确保团队始终使用最新文档。
2.3 数据驱动决策:报表与预警机制
系统需提供可操作的洞察:
- 动态报表生成:基于Chart.js生成任务完成率、延期预警热力图。某SaaS企业通过该功能,将项目延期率从30%降至12%。
- AI预警模块:通过简单规则引擎(如任务延期超过2天自动触发通知),主动提醒风险。避免“问题积压到最后一刻”的常见失误。
三、技术栈选型与实现路径
3.1 前端框架:轻量优先原则
HTML项目管理系统无需复杂架构。推荐技术栈:
- 核心:纯HTML/CSS/JS——避免框架臃肿(如React/Vue),适合小型团队快速启动。示例:使用原生Fetch API获取数据,减少依赖。
- 增强:轻量库辅助——关键功能引入小而美的库:Sortable.js(拖拽排序)、Chart.js(图表)、Flatpickr(日期选择器),总代码量控制在50KB内。
对比传统方案:某团队曾尝试用Angular搭建,结果因学习曲线导致开发周期延长6周;转用纯HTML+轻量库后,仅需3周完成基础版,且后续维护成本降低70%。
3.2 后端支持:最小化数据存储
系统无需独立后端,推荐以下低成本方案:
- 本地存储(localStorage):适用于1-5人团队,数据仅保存在用户浏览器。优势:无需服务器成本,适合初创团队。
- 云存储(Firebase Realtime Database):支持多人实时同步,免费额度足够小型团队使用(每月5GB)。实现示例:通过Firebase SDK实现任务增删改查。
避坑指南:避免过度设计。某企业曾投入2个月开发自研后端,结果因数据量小导致资源浪费。采用Firebase后,系统启动时间从3周缩至3天。
四、分阶段实施步骤详解
4.1 需求分析:聚焦关键痛点
避免“功能堆砌”,优先解决团队最痛的3个问题。例如:
- 任务分配混乱(如口头交接导致遗漏)
- 进度信息不透明(每周例会耗时过长)
- 文件版本混乱(反复发送不同版本的PDF)
实施方法:组织1小时需求研讨会,用“痛点-解决方案”矩阵表收集意见。某游戏公司通过此步骤,聚焦任务自动化分配,上线后沟通成本降低40%。
4.2 原型设计:快速验证思路
用纸笔或Figma制作低保真原型,重点验证核心流程。例如:
关键原则:原型迭代3次内完成。某团队原计划用2周设计,改为1天完成原型后,发现需求偏差,避免了后续200小时的无效开发。
4.3 开发实现:模块化构建
按功能模块分阶段开发,每阶段交付可运行版本:
| 阶段 | 核心功能 | 交付时间 | 验收标准 |
|---|---|---|---|
| 第一阶段 | 任务创建与分配 | 2周 | 支持拖拽分配,数据存本地存储 |
| 第二阶段 | 进度看板与报表 | 1周 | 甘特图显示任务依赖,生成简单完成率图表 |
| 第三阶段 | 团队通知与文件管理 | 1.5周 | 任务更新自动发通知,支持文档版本记录 |
4.4 测试与迭代:用户驱动优化
上线前进行三轮测试:
- 内部测试:开发团队模拟使用,重点找流程卡点。
- 小范围试用:选1-2个小组试用1周,收集反馈(如“任务截止日期提醒太晚”)。
- 持续优化:根据反馈每周迭代1个功能。某团队通过此方式,在3个月内完成12次关键优化。
五、成功案例与避坑指南
5.1 案例:某跨境电商团队的转型实践
该团队原用邮件+Excel管理20+项目,导致30%的订单需求因沟通遗漏而返工。实施基于HTML的系统后:
- 任务分配从“口头”转为“系统自动分配”,需求遗漏率下降至8%
- 通过甘特图,提前发现3个关键路径阻塞点,避免了2周延期
- 团队会议时长从2小时压缩至30分钟,因信息同步效率提升
投资回报率(ROI):系统开发成本约2000美元(含1人2周开发),3个月内节省沟通成本12000美元。
5.2 关键避坑指南
- 误区:追求大而全——先做最小可行产品(MVP),再扩展功能。某公司投入10人月开发完整功能,结果仅20%被使用。
- 误区:忽视移动端——确保响应式设计(使用Bootstrap 5),87%的团队成员需在手机上快速查看任务(据Forrester调研)。
- 误区:忽略数据安全——即使本地存储,也需对敏感数据(如客户信息)做加密处理(如使用CryptoJS库)。
六、未来趋势:智能化与生态融合
随着技术演进,HTML项目管理系统将向以下方向发展:
- AI深度整合:自动预测任务延期风险(基于历史数据),如使用简单回归模型分析进度偏差。
- 生态化扩展:通过开放API与企业微信、钉钉等办公平台集成,实现“一键同步”。
- 低代码化:提供可视化配置界面,让非技术人员也能自定义流程(如拖拽设置审批规则)。
例如,某开发工具平台已推出“项目管理模块”,允许用户通过图形界面配置任务流,无需编码,上线后用户采用率在3个月内达65%。
结论:从工具到文化变革
构建HTML项目管理系统不仅是技术实现,更是团队协作文化的重塑。成功的系统需满足三个核心:**简单到无需培训**(新成员30分钟上手)、**实时到无需追问**(状态变化自动同步)、**价值到可见可感**(用数据证明效率提升)。正如硅谷创业导师所言:“工具的价值不在于功能多少,而在于是否解决了真实痛点。”当团队从“被动响应需求”转向“主动规划节奏”,项目管理便从成本中心转变为价值引擎。建议企业从1-2个核心痛点切入,用最小成本验证效果,逐步构建可持续的协作生态。未来,随着Web技术的轻量化与智能化,这类系统将成为企业数字化转型的基石,而非可选项。





